    Optical cable traction machines are widely used in optical fiber communication, power, and municipal engineering for cable laying and construction. They can lay up to 288-core optical cables in underground, overhead, or pipeline scenarios, with automatic pre-tension. Cable tray systems are engineered support structures designed to route, support, and protect insulated electrical cables used for power distribution, control, instrumentation, and communication.

    Disconnect the fiber from the equipment (ONT, OLT splitter port) you want to test the power at. The meter automatically separates each wavelength and displays power for downstream and upstream simultaneously. An optical power meter is a key tool that measures light strength in the fiber, helping identify signal losses or connection problems. The basic process is straightforward: turn the meter on, set it to the correct wavelength, clean your connectors, plug in, and read the.
